The Chargers are allowing 20.1 points per game to opponents and the Broncos are averaging 23.9 PPG. Combined and divided by two, that's 22 points Denver's way. That same formula for the Broncos' defense and L.A.'s offense spits out 21.3 points for the Chargers. Fans in Denver will hope the math adds up to a Broncos win in Week 18.

The Los Angeles Chargers have clinched a playoff berth, but they also control their own destiny for the AFC West. If they win their final two games, then they'll jump the Denver Broncos. L.A. would own the tiebreaker against Denver by virtue of a 2-0 head-to-head record.
